V. Kesava Rao is a scholar working on Electronic, Optical and Magnetic Materials, Materials Chemistry and Biomedical Engineering. According to data from OpenAlex, V. Kesava Rao has authored 12 papers receiving a total of 380 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Electronic, Optical and Magnetic Materials, 6 papers in Materials Chemistry and 6 papers in Biomedical Engineering. Recurrent topics in V. Kesava Rao’s work include Gold and Silver Nanoparticles Synthesis and Applications (7 papers), Spectroscopy Techniques in Biomedical and Chemical Research (2 papers) and Polydiacetylene-based materials and applications (2 papers). V. Kesava Rao is often cited by papers focused on Gold and Silver Nanoparticles Synthesis and Applications (7 papers), Spectroscopy Techniques in Biomedical and Chemical Research (2 papers) and Polydiacetylene-based materials and applications (2 papers). V. Kesava Rao collaborates with scholars based in India, Japan and United States. V. Kesava Rao's co-authors include T. P. Radhakrishnan, Raz Jelinek, Masamichi Yoshimura, Yasutaka Kitahama and Keisuke Goda and has published in prestigious journals such as The Journal of Physical Chemistry C, ACS Applied Materials & Interfaces and Journal of Materials Chemistry A.
